Hanoi: launching National Week of Clean Water and Environment Hygiene
The National Week of Clean Water and Environment Hygiene themed “Clean water and environmental sanitation for the comprehensive development of children” has recently been launched in Hanoi.

Jointly organized by the Ministry of Agricultural and Rural Development (MARD) and People’s Committee of Chuong My District, the event aims at raising public awareness on the importance of protecting the environment and saving water resources to reduce damage caused by climate change, contributing to protecting the health of children in particular and the whole community in general.
Hanoi always pays much attention to protecting the environment and providing clean water. It is identified as an important socio-economic indicator of the city. Statistic showed that about 8.65 percent of the rural population in the province was able to access to clean water while 94.85 percent of the rural households had sanitary toilets and facilities by the end of 2016.
The national week will take place from April 15 to May 15. It can be extended until June 5, and mixed with the nation's big festivals (the Liberation Reunification Day on April 30 and the International Workers’ Day on May 1).
